Abstract EN
Bambara groundnut (Vigna subterranea (L.) Verdc.) is an indigenous grain legume.
It occupies a prominent place in the strategies to ensure food security in sub-Saharan Africa.
Development of an efficient in vitro regeneration system, a prerequisite for genetic transformation application, requires the establishment of optimal conditions for seeds germination and plantlets development.
Three types of seeds were inoculated on different basal media devoid of growth regulators.
Various strengths of the medium of choice and the type and concentration of carbon source were also investigated.
Responses to germination varied with the type of seed.
Embryonic axis (EA) followed by seeds without coat (SWtC) germinated rapidly and expressed a high rate of germination.
The growth performances of plantlets varied with the basal medium composition and the seeds type.
The optimal growth performances of plants were displayed on half strength MS basal medium with SWtC and EA as source of seeds.
Addition of 3% sucrose in the culture medium was more suitable for a maximum growth of plantlets derived from EA.
